Dear Customer Service Manager,
I am writing to formally express my dissatisfaction with a recent purchase from your company, ElectroTech Appliances. On December 15th, I bought a Model E9000 smart refrigerator from your store located in Uptown Mall. Unfortunately, I have experienced persistent issues with the device that significantly affect its functionality and my satisfaction as a customer.
The refrigerator malfunctioned within two weeks of purchase. It failed to maintain an adequate cold temperature, causing spoilage of perishable food items stored inside. Despite following the troubleshooting steps outlined in your user manual, the problem persisted. I contacted your customer support helpline on December 28th, and I was advised to reset the appliance and ensure proper ventilation. However, these measures did not resolve the issue.
Additionally, the refrigerator emits an unusually loud buzzing noise, which is disruptive and has become a source of constant disturbance in my home. This noise level exceeds limits specified by industry standards, indicating a probable defect in the compressor or motor assembly. Given that the appliance is still under the warranty period, I expected it to function properly and without issue.
I am disappointed with the quality of this product, especially considering the reputation of ElectroTech Appliances for high-quality electronics. I require an immediate resolution to this problem. I kindly request a full refund or a replacement unit of the same model at no additional cost. Furthermore, I expect the defective appliance to be picked up from my residence at your earliest convenience.
Please inform me of the steps you will take within the next seven business days to address this complaint. I believe a prompt response is necessary to maintain your company's commitment to customer satisfaction. Failure to resolve this issue promptly will leave me no choice but to escalate the matter to consumer protection agencies and seek legal remedies.
Thank you for your immediate attention to this matter. I look forward to your swift response and a satisfactory resolution.
Sincerely,
